用foreach来遍历数组

原创 2017年01月03日 17:51:25

我们定义一个数组,可以用foreach来遍历该数组所有的内容并输出。

<?php
  $arr=array('a'=>'dog','b'=>'monkey','c'=>'pen');
  foreach($arr as $val){
    echo $val;
    echo "<br />";
  }
?>

但是在实际开发中,我们往往不这么用,因为要按格式化数组检索结果,一般结合html的表格处理,用while或者for循环。

基本上是关联数组,比如数据库检索出来的结果,页面形式呈现,部分代码如下(假设已经连上mysql数据库,并且结果集有数据不为空):

<?php

$sql="select * from student ";
$res=mysql_query($sql);
echo "<table border='1px' bordercolor='blue' cellspacing='0px' >";
echo "<tr><th>id</th><th>用户名</th><th>学号</th><th>性别</th>";
//循环显示用户的信息
while($row=mysql_fetch_assoc($res))
{
?>
<tr>
       <td>&nbsp;<?php echo $row['id'];?></td>
  <td><?php echo $row['name']; ?></td>
   <td><?php echo $row['sno']; ?></td>
  <td><?php echo $row['sex']?></td>

</tr>

<?php

  }

?>

foreach循环遍历二维数组

array(3) {   [0]=>   array(8) {   ["degreesid"]=>   string(1) "1"   ["degreeid"]=>   str...
  • A9925
  • A9925
  • 2014年12月23日 14:43
  • 2647

PHP 数组遍历 foreach 语法结构

来源:http://www.cnblogs.com/keta/p/6117237.html foreach 语法结构用于遍历数组。 foreach() PHP for...

forEach方法遍历数组

1.  js 数组循环遍历。 数组循环变量,最先想到的就是 for(var i=0;i 除此之外,也可以使用较简便的forEach 方式 2.  forEach ...

PHP中使用foreach()遍历二维数组

echo ""; echo "php遍历二维数组"; //$team = array('lk','ok'); //$book = array('linux服务器配置与管理',$...
  • A9925
  • A9925
  • 2015年08月17日 19:08
  • 2982

js---js中数组遍历方法forEach与map()有什么区别?

JS原生forEach与map1 . 共同点 //1.都是循环遍历数组中的每一项。//2.forEach() 和 map() 里面每一次执行匿名函数都支持3个参数:数组中的当前项item,当前项的索引...
  • Wbiokr
  • Wbiokr
  • 2017年11月15日 21:28
  • 58

Javascript 数组循环遍历之forEach

目录(?)[-] js 数组循环遍历forEach 函数让IE兼容forEach方法如何跳出循环 1.  js 数组循环遍历。 数组循环变量,最先想到的就是 for(va...
  • kdsde
  • kdsde
  • 2013年03月14日 13:23
  • 774

PHP中的foreach遍历数组

foreach主要用于数组的循环变量,所以我们在这里只是以数组为例举两个例子,尽快的理解和学会使用foreach循环操作。下面代码是获取数组$students中的所有下标和值同时遍历出来...
  • LHJBK
  • LHJBK
  • 2016年05月28日 15:33
  • 588

Javascript 数组循环遍历之forEach

1.  js 数组循环遍历。 数组循环变量,最先想到的就是 for(var i=0;i 除此之外,也可以使用较简便的forEach 方式 2.  forEach ...
  • yzbben
  • yzbben
  • 2016年11月17日 09:36
  • 108

Javascript 数组循环遍历之forEach

1.  js 数组循环遍历。 数组循环变量,最先想到的就是 for(var i=0;i 除此之外,也可以使用较简便的forEach 方式   2.  forEach 函数。 Firefox ...

PHP 数组遍历 foreach 语法结构

移步至个人小站:www.very321.com http://www.5idev.com/p-php_array_foreach.shtml PHP 数组遍历 foreach 语法结构 ...
  • wjh168
  • wjh168
  • 2012年06月05日 14:43
  • 423
内容举报
返回顶部
收藏助手
不良信息举报
您举报文章:用foreach来遍历数组
举报原因:
原因补充:

(最多只允许输入30个字)